From 6bc066dc73acf1d767503927bd00608af312003f Mon Sep 17 00:00:00 2001 From: Mingshen Sun Date: Tue, 14 Mar 2023 21:15:16 -0700 Subject: [PATCH] Fix the search bar becoming first reponder issue in macOS --- pass/Controllers/PasswordNavigationViewController.swift |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pass/Controllers/PasswordNavigationViewController.swift b/pass/Controllers/PasswordNavigationViewController.swift index 9e5973e..7f41b62 100644 --- a/pass/Controllers/PasswordNavigationViewController.swift +++ b/pass/Controllers/PasswordNavigationViewController.swift @@ -112,9 +112,9 @@ class PasswordNavigationViewController: UIViewController { override func viewDidAppear(_ animated: Bool) { super.viewDidAppear(animated) - if searchText != nil { + if let text = searchText, !text.isEmpty { DispatchQueue.main.async { - self.searchBar.text = self.searchText + self.searchBar.text = text self.searchController.isActive = true self.searchBar.becomeFirstResponder() }